The Responsibilities of a Medical Assistant

medical assistant with Whites Creek TN nursing home patientThe function of a medical assistant can be varied as well as challenging. Primarily their job is to make sure that the Whites Creek TN hospitals, clinics and other medical care institutions where they work operate successfully. Depending on the type or size of facility, they can be more of an administrative assistant, a clinical assistant, or in smaller facilities both. They are tasked with giving direct support to the nurses, doctors and other health professionals but can also be found performing duties at the front desk or in an office. Some of the possible functions of a medical assistant include:

  • Completing insurance forms and filing claims
  • Setting and verifying appointments
  • Taking vital signs and weighing patients
  • Taking blood and other tissue and fluid samples
  • Preparing rooms and instruments for physicians
  • Supplying basic support during examinations and procedures

Although medical assistants can perform almost any task they are qualified to under Tennessee law, some choose to specialize in a particular area and obtain certification. Two of the options available are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) offered by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Training Programs

In contrast to most other medical practitioners, medical assistants are not mandated to become licensed, certified, or to have a college degree. However, a number of Whites Creek TN health care employers would rather h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training program (more on accreditation later ) that are certified. There are essentially 2 choices available for a formal education. The first and shortest route to becoming a medical assistant is to obtain a diploma or a certificate. These programs usually take about a year to finish, a few as little as 6 to 9 months. They are developed to teach the fundamentals of medical assisting and ready graduates for entry level positions. The second alternative is to obtain an Associate Degree, which are usually two year programs provided at community and junior colleges in addition to technical and vocational schools. They are more comprehensive in design than the certificate or diploma programs, and include liberal arts courses in addition to the medical assistant classes. They often have a practical element requiring an internship with a local healthcare practice. Associate Degrees are commonly a pre-requisite for and credits can be applied to a 4 year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a similar field.

Certification Options for Medical Assistants

As earlier stated, becoming certified is not a legal requirement, but is an excellent option for graduates who wish to boost their careers. It will not only help in attaining a position after graduation, but it may also enhance preliminary salary negotiations. A number of potential Whites Creek TN medical employers simply will not employ a medical assistant that has not obtained accredited formal training or certification. The most popular and arguably the most respected cert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) offered by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). To qualify to apply for the CMA examination, a candidate must have graduated or will be graduating within thirty days from an accredited medical assistant program. Additional certifications are offered as well, such as the CCMA and the CMAA that we previously mentioned which are provided by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ant Program Accredited? There are a number of good reasons to confirm that the school you enroll in is accredited. First, accreditation helps guarantee that the instruction you receive will be both comprehensive and of the highest quality. Next, if you plan on becoming certified, you need to complete an accredited program. Two of the accepted organizations for accreditation are the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ES) and the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). If your program is not accredited by either of these organizations, you will not be allowed to take the CMA exam. Also, if you intend on applying for a student loan or financial assistance, they are normally not offered for non-accredited programs. And last, as mentioned previously, a number of potential Whites Creek TN employers will not hire a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ited school.

Whites Creek, Tennessee

Whites Creek is a neighborhood of Nashville in the northern part of Davidson County, Tennessee. The community is named for the creek of the same name running north-south along U.S. Route 431. The Whites Creek area has its own US Post Office, with the ZIP Code 37189.

The historic Whites Creek District was established in 1780 and has some of the best preserved examples of the architectural and historical significance of this era in Middle Tennessee.[citation needed] It is now a part of Metro Nashville.

The criminal James Gang visited Whites Creek and rested there in the 1800s. Gang member Bill Ryan was arrested on March 25, 1881 in Whites Creek, prompting gang leaders Frank and Jesse James to leave the area.[citation needed]
